Nail Swatch: OPI Mod About You

I was too busy to head down to town to do my manicure so i end up doing it myself at home. So my second finger nail ends up to the shortest compare to the others lolx. Anyway, i apply a fresh new polish on my nails yesterday with OPI Mod About You. This polish gave them a refreshing and pinky purplish look. Formula & brush tip was great as usual for OPI polish so not elaborating further on my love for it.
Below was two coats of application.

  8. Mod About You is my favourite summer pink. The slight lilac tinge to it and the way it is opague after two coats makes it a hit IMO. Most pinks are too peachy or too bright for my taste. I read a lot of reviews that complained about it chipping easily. I have had no such issues. I wear it over a shellac top coat, so maybe that is the reason why I don;t get chips.
